Skip to content

Commit b2308f2

Browse files
committed
CODE OF CONDUCT
1 parent a6b4dd8 commit b2308f2

File tree

2 files changed

+171
-0
lines changed

2 files changed

+171
-0
lines changed

CODE_OF_CONDUCT.md

Lines changed: 97 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,97 @@
1+
# 🧭 Code of Product
2+
3+
This document outlines the core principles and values that guide the development of the **F1F Discord Bot**. It serves as a compass for making product decisions, prioritizing features, and staying aligned with our long-term goals.
4+
5+
---
6+
7+
## 🎯 1. Purpose-Driven Development
8+
9+
We build features that **serve a clear purpose** and **solve real needs** within our community. Every command, every update should bring value to users and enhance the overall Discord experience.
10+
11+
> If it doesn’t make the user experience better — we don’t build it.
12+
13+
---
14+
15+
## 👥 2. Built for the Community, with the Community
16+
17+
The bot is created **by fans, for fans**. We believe in co-building with the community through feedback, open discussions, and transparent roadmaps.
18+
19+
- User feedback guides our priorities.
20+
- Every voice matters, especially newcomers.
21+
- Simplicity beats complexity, always.
22+
23+
---
24+
25+
## 🛡️ 3. Security First
26+
27+
Security is not a feature, it’s a foundation.
28+
29+
- We minimize permissions required by the bot.
30+
- We follow best practices for API usage and data handling.
31+
- All contributions must respect our [Security Policy](SECURITY.md).
32+
33+
---
34+
35+
## ⚙️ 4. Maintainability over Quick Fixes
36+
37+
Fast is good, but **clean and maintainable** is better.
38+
39+
- Code should be easy to read, test, and extend.
40+
- We write documentation for features and architecture.
41+
- Refactoring is encouraged when it improves stability.
42+
43+
---
44+
45+
## 📈 5. Iteration, Not Perfection
46+
47+
We launch features iteratively. Early versions may be simple, but they allow us to gather feedback and improve over time.
48+
49+
- MVPs (Minimum Viable Products) are welcome.
50+
- Mistakes are learning opportunities — we fix and move forward.
51+
52+
---
53+
54+
## 🧪 6. Transparency in Experiments
55+
56+
We test new ideas **openly and honestly**, and we’re not afraid to sunset features that don’t work.
57+
58+
- Experiments are labeled as such.
59+
- All major changes are communicated to users.
60+
- Data and feedback drive decisions, not assumptions.
61+
62+
---
63+
64+
## 🧬 7. The Bot Reflects the Brand
65+
66+
The F1F Bot should reflect the **tone, values, and identity** of Formula 1 France:
67+
68+
- Passionate
69+
- Respectful
70+
- Welcoming
71+
- Playful (but never annoying)
72+
73+
---
74+
75+
## 💬 8. Communication is Key
76+
77+
Whether it’s with contributors or users, **clear and consistent communication** is essential.
78+
79+
- We document what's been done and what’s coming.
80+
- We keep users informed via Discord announcements, GitHub discussions, and changelogs.
81+
82+
---
83+
84+
## 🏁 9. We Play the Long Game
85+
86+
This project is a marathon, not a sprint. We invest in:
87+
88+
- Quality infrastructure
89+
- Developer tooling
90+
- Scalable design decisions
91+
92+
We aim to keep the bot running for the seasons to come. 🏎️
93+
94+
---
95+
96+
**Built with love and community spirit by the F1F team.**
97+
*All contributors are welcome on the grid.* 🏁

log/app.log

Lines changed: 74 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-169,3 +169,77 @@ BOT LANCER 11/07/2025 15:47:38
169169
2025-07-16 11:12:33,565 - INFO - [matt_karting] Lecture du fichier JSON réussie : ../data/resultats_qualif.json
170170
2025-07-16 11:12:33,812 - INFO - [matt_karting] Lecture du fichier Excel réussie : ../data/Result_Qualif_Pronos_F1F_DEMO.xlsx
171171
2025-07-16 11:12:33,844 - INFO - ✅ Classement sauvegardé dans : ../data/Classement_Qualif.xlsx
172+
2025-07-16 13:31:30,166 - INFO - BOT LANCER
173+
2025-07-17 10:31:22,603 - INFO - BOT LANCER
174+
2025-07-17 10:31:37,858 - INFO - [matt_karting] Lecture du fichier JSON réussie : ../data/resultats_qualif.json
175+
2025-07-17 10:31:38,672 - INFO - [matt_karting] Lecture du fichier Excel réussie : ../data/Result_Qualif_Pronos_F1F_DEMO.xlsx
176+
2025-07-17 10:31:38,694 - INFO - ✅ Classement sauvegardé dans : ../data/Classement_Qualif.xlsx
177+
2025-07-17 10:43:02,757 - INFO - BOT LANCER
178+
2025-07-17 10:54:39,861 - INFO - BOT LANCER
179+
2025-07-17 10:55:46,653 - ERROR - Erreur pendant le ban : Member.ban() got an unexpected keyword argument 'article'
180+
2025-07-17 12:21:35,478 - INFO - BOT LANCER
181+
2025-07-17 12:26:08,211 - INFO - BOT LANCER
182+
2025-07-17 12:26:41,460 - INFO - BOT LANCER
183+
2025-07-17 15:10:28,230 - INFO - BOT LANCER
184+
2025-07-17 15:13:02,828 - INFO - BOT LANCER
185+
2025-07-17 15:16:38,255 - INFO - BOT LANCER
186+
2025-07-17 15:18:53,914 - INFO - BOT LANCER
187+
2025-07-17 15:19:37,136 - INFO - BOT LANCER
188+
2025-07-17 15:21:13,862 - INFO - BOT LANCER
189+
2025-07-17 15:23:16,426 - INFO - BOT LANCER
190+
2025-07-17 15:27:07,644 - INFO - BOT LANCER
191+
2025-07-17 15:28:25,704 - INFO - BOT LANCER
192+
2025-07-17 15:37:11,061 - INFO - BOT LANCER
193+
2025-07-17 15:45:43,439 - INFO - BOT LANCER
194+
2025-07-17 15:47:05,211 - INFO - BOT LANCER
195+
2025-07-17 15:56:55,719 - INFO - BOT LANCER
196+
2025-07-17 15:58:23,893 - INFO - BOT LANCER
197+
2025-07-17 15:59:51,362 - INFO - BOT LANCER
198+
2025-07-17 15:59:58,082 - INFO - matt_karting a tenter de regarder ses pronos course alors qu'il n'en avais pas fais
199+
2025-07-17 16:01:03,204 - INFO - BOT LANCER
200+
2025-07-17 16:01:07,995 - INFO - matt_karting a tenter de regarder ses pronos course alors qu'il n'en avais pas fais
201+
2025-07-18 11:23:59,190 - INFO - BOT LANCER
202+
2025-07-18 11:24:25,258 - INFO - matt_karting à demander présentation dans le salon général
203+
2025-07-18 11:27:03,511 - INFO - sf211921 à demander présentation dans le salon général
204+
2025-07-18 11:44:17,520 - INFO - BOT LANCER
205+
2025-07-18 11:48:39,551 - INFO - BOT LANCER
206+
2025-07-18 11:50:06,282 - INFO - BOT LANCER
207+
2025-07-18 11:57:04,060 - INFO - BOT LANCER
208+
2025-07-18 11:58:56,452 - INFO - BOT LANCER
209+
2025-07-18 11:59:58,278 - INFO - whisper9741 à demander une présentation dans le salon général
210+
2025-07-18 12:02:33,044 - INFO - BOT LANCER
211+
2025-07-18 12:03:02,897 - INFO - BOT LANCER
212+
2025-07-18 12:05:29,828 - INFO - BOT LANCER
213+
2025-07-18 12:06:05,619 - INFO - matt_karting à demander une présentation dans le salon général
214+
2025-07-18 12:07:58,828 - INFO - BOT LANCER
215+
2025-07-18 12:08:24,395 - INFO - matt_karting à demander une présentation dans le salon général
216+
2025-07-18 12:08:59,635 - INFO - BOT LANCER
217+
2025-07-18 12:09:28,097 - INFO - BOT LANCER
218+
2025-07-18 12:10:17,550 - INFO - BOT LANCER
219+
2025-07-18 12:30:34,529 - INFO - la_bagguette a tenter de regarder ses pronos course alors qu'il n'en avais pas fais
220+
2025-07-18 12:34:10,384 - INFO - la_bagguette à demander une présentation dans le salon général
221+
2025-07-18 13:56:33,047 - INFO - BOT LANCER
222+
2025-07-18 15:32:42,772 - INFO - BOT LANCER
223+
2025-07-18 16:27:52,967 - ERROR - Erreur pendant le ban : Member.ban() got an unexpected keyword argument 'article'
224+
2025-07-18 16:29:53,301 - INFO - BOT LANCER
225+
2025-07-18 23:08:28,923 - INFO - BOT LANCER
226+
2025-07-18 23:26:17,424 - INFO - BOT LANCER
227+
2025-07-19 00:31:33,285 - INFO - BOT LANCER
228+
2025-07-19 00:33:18,786 - INFO - matt_karting à demander une présentation dans le salon général
229+
2025-07-19 12:50:51,304 - INFO - BOT LANCER
230+
2025-07-19 12:50:56,195 - INFO - BOT LANCER
231+
2025-07-19 13:01:48,741 - INFO - BOT LANCER
232+
2025-07-20 09:23:33,306 - INFO - BOT LANCER
233+
2025-07-21 09:30:25,179 - INFO - BOT LANCER
234+
2025-07-21 10:06:22,255 - INFO - BOT LANCER
235+
2025-07-21 10:06:44,384 - INFO - Présentation par matt_karting dans général sur TEST F1F
236+
2025-07-21 10:52:17,276 - INFO - BOT LANCER
237+
2025-07-21 12:02:01,853 - INFO - BOT LANCER
238+
2025-07-21 14:40:46,810 - INFO - BOT LANCER
239+
2025-07-21 14:41:04,790 - INFO - Présentation par matt_karting dans ⭐・paddock-général sur Formula 1 France
240+
2025-07-21 14:55:06,030 - INFO - BOT LANCER
241+
2025-07-21 15:02:32,769 - INFO - Présentation par matt_karting dans ⭐・paddock-vip sur Formula 1 France
242+
2025-07-21 16:12:34,824 - INFO - Présentation par whisper9741 dans ⭐・paddock-général sur Formula 1 France
243+
2025-07-21 16:15:18,996 - INFO - Présentation par leahf1 dans ⭐・paddock-général sur Formula 1 France
244+
2025-07-21 16:22:41,024 - INFO - Présentation par matt_karting dans ⭐・paddock-vip sur Formula 1 France
245+
2025-07-21 16:34:59,438 - INFO - Présentation par tigerone4980 dans 🎂・anniversaire sur Formula 1 France

0 commit comments

Comments
 (0)